Crohn's Disease

Crohn's disease is an IBD or inflammatory bowel disease that affects the GI or gastrointestinal tract. Crohn's disease causes the inflammation and swelling of the digestive tract and most ordinarily affects the ileum or little intestine, however, this disease will affect any space of the gastrointestinal tract starting at the mouth all the way down to the anus.

Whereas Crohn's disease could be a life long illness for that there's no cure, varied treatment methods and therapies are effective for several individuals in controlling the symptoms and they are ready to guide comparatively traditional and productive lives.

The Symptoms and Causes of Crohn's Disease

The inflammation of the GI tract because of Crohn's disease causes several uncomfortable symptoms as well as gentle to severe pain in the abdominal space and diarrhea that is usually severe. This disease will conjointly cause malnutrition because it can cause malabsorption that is the inability to absorb a sufficient quantity of the essential vitamins and nutrients and it may conjointly cause intestinal protein loss.

Individuals with Crohn's disease typically experience a loss of appetite that may also cause them to own poor dietary habits ensuing in malnutrition. While researchers and scientists have not been in a position to search out a definitive answer as to what it's exactly that causes Crohn's disease, their research suggests that it could be an abnormal reaction of the body's immune system that mistakenly treats foods, bacteria, and other substances as foreign.

This immune system response causes elevated levels of white blood cells within the intestinal lining causing the intestines to become chronically inflamed leading to break and ulcerations of the bowel, but, researchers are not certain whether this abnormal immune system reaction really causes Crohn's disease or is a result of having this condition. Some research also suggests that this may be a genetic or inherited disease as it's seen in many individuals who have a sibling or parent with the same condition.

Treatment for Crohn's Disease


As of today, there is no cure for Crohn's disease and treatment is aimed at providing relief from the symptoms and therefore the sort of treatment depends upon the severity and placement that's tormented by the disease. In some cases, individuals can experience long run remission from this disease after medical treatment that usually consists of medication and sometimes surgery.

The medications that are typically prescribed and used as the first step within the treatment process are anti-inflammatory medicine to reduce the inflammation that is accountable for causing the symptoms. But, there are various varieties of those drugs that job differently among people and it could take several attempts in finding the one that right for the patient. Some of these medications also are capable of causing serious aspect effects and also the risks involved should forever be weighed compared to the benefits.

In more severe cases of Crohn's disease or when other makes an attempt at treatment have failed, surgery could be performed so as to repair or take away the broken portions of the GI tract. Approximately three out of each four individuals who have Crohn's disease can would like surgery at some point in their life, however, this typically only provides a brief kind of relief and half of these people can want to undergo a second surgical operation and possibly even more.

If you suffer from Crohn's disease, it's essential that you simply follow any treatment plan prescribed by your physician and that you get regular check ups so as to avoid a lot of serious complications that can conjointly become life-threatening.
